"Despite Dallas County’s shelter-in-place order, I’m reporting that Zalat Pizza is expanding: the local chain will open its seventh location on Monday, April 13, at 4007 Lemmon Ave., Suite B. The new outpost was always planned as a cloud kitchen with no dining room and will offer takeout and delivery via third-party apps, serving beef pepperoni and pho-inspired pies. Founder and CEO Khanh Nguyen says the cloud-kitchen model is especially appropriate now and that the company is implementing health standards and safety precautions for staff and third-party drivers; the brand already has high delivery volumes. This Lemmon Avenue location will not initially have the late hours the brand is known for — it will be open 4 p.m.–midnight Monday–Thursday, noon–2 a.m. Friday–Saturday, and noon–midnight Sunday, with plans to eventually extend hours until 4 a.m." - Adele Chapin
